Minnesota Annual Meeting and New Member Induction
May 9, 2017

LAI Minnesota welcomed 15 new members in the class of ’17. They represent a broad cross-section of disciplines the greaer Twin Cities Region. Featured speaker for the luncheon was WCCO-CBS Political Reporter, Pat Kessler. Mr. Kessler provided a candid, and sometimes entertaining, insider’s view of this year’s Legislative session.
